read.y PREPARED5red7iadj [not gradable]prepared and suitable for immediate activity准备好了的,就绪的"The dinner's ready, " she called out.“饭好了。”她叫道。"Are you ready? Hurry up -- we're late. "“你好了吗?快点----我们迟了。”I quickly finish dressing in the morning when my mother says, "Get ready. We have to leave."早晨在我母亲说完“准备好。我们得走了。”后我很快就穿好了衣服。The concert hall was made ready (= prepared) for the performance.音乐厅为演出准备就绪。The waiter came over to the table and asked, "Are you ready to order?" [+ to infinitive]招待走到桌旁问道:“你准备点菜了吗?”He looked ready to (= as if he would very soon) collapse. [+ to infinitive]他看上去身体随时要垮掉的样子。Ready to also means willing to.愿意的,乐意的What good friends you have -- they're always ready to help you out. [+ to infinitive]你有多好的朋友----他们总是乐意帮助你解决困难。They weren't ready to lend me the money. [+ to infinitive]他们不愿意借钱给我。(disapproving) If you are too ready with something you are too eager to do it.热切的,动辄就…的He's too ready with (= too eager to give) his advice.他过于热心给人忠告。Secret information allowed the police to be ready and waiting (= waiting and prepared to act) when the robbers came out of the bank.秘密情报使得警察可以等待,候着抢劫者从银行出来。The sheriff slept with his gun ready to hand (= close to him and prepared for use) under his pillow.警长睡觉时把他的枪放在枕头下,随时可用。He stood by the phone, pencil at the ready (= prepared to write).他站在电话机旁,手里拿着铅笔随时准备记录。(Br) Ready, steady, go! is said at the start of a race, esp. one for children.预备----跑Clothes that are ready-to-wear (Br and Aus also off-the-peg, Am also off-the-rack) are produced in standard sizes and not made to fit a particular person.成衣,现成做好的服装If something is ready-made it has been found or bought in a finished form or is available to use immediately.现成的,做好的ready-made frozen meals现成的冷冻菜肴I didn't make the birthday cake myself -- I bought it ready-made.我没有自己做生日蛋糕----我买了现成的。When she married Giles, she acquired a ready-made family-- two teenage sons and a daughter.她同贾尔斯结婚时,她就有了个现成的家庭----两个十几岁的儿子和一个女儿。(dated infml) Ready money is money that is available to be spent immediately.现钱,手头有的钱 [readies]"No cucumbers in the market, not even for ready money" (Oscar Wilde in the play The lmportance of Being Earnst, 1895)“市场上没黄瓜,现钱也买不到。”(摘自戏剧《认真的重要》,奥斯卡·王尔德)
